Anna GoldfederAnna Goldfeder
Fun little dog-friendly 2km track to wander through so beautiful greenery. Kinda awesome to have the urban/forest vibe and get lost amongst the trees. Isn’t particularly difficult but a few rocks to walk up and down if you’re not super stable on your feet. Usually things like trees to hold on to. Our small dog isn’t super confident on open grated surfaces so we had to carry her over a few bits but they’re not long stretches - some stairs and a few paths. Nice parks at both ends and wouldn’t be hard to extend the walk.
James CarltonJames Carlton
Wonderful bushwalk so close to the inner west. If you're walking your dog, the middle section has a longish boardwalk and a steep set of stairs made of a widely spaced metal grate that your pup probably won't want to walk on. If you're not comfortable carrying your dog for 30-40 metres you'll need to turn back halfway. Still a beautiful walk for you and your dog. Enter from the East if you still want to see the fruit bat colony.
Sara HSara H
Very nice walk not too far from the city, the trail isn't very hard and and the dogs enjoyed it, walking to the flying foxes camp was so cool and seeing the camp was so amazing I would definitely recommend doing this hike on a nice day as a change from the normal beach day
